Radio One Weekend Ibiza 2010: The Build Up

Thursday 18th February 2010 - 10:20

Looking towards the Radio One Weekend in Ibiza 2010, NonStopIbiza looks at how the weekend has developed into the legendary status it now holds, as one of the biggest weekends in the Ibiza season.

Since 1995 the Radio One Ibiza weekend has been part of the stable August diet. Like all dietarians, whose main principle is to mislay and feel good, the weekend shares a similar ethos.

The impact of Radio One’s residency and decision to host a weekend will no doubt be entrenched in the memories of those present. Then again, you didn’t even need to be there, listening at home or on your journey to a domestic night, making plans for next summer’s holiday, transcended the excitement.

Radio One broadcasted at Privilege (called Ku at the time) in 1995 with club promoter Cream and has continued an affiliation. Cream and the Radio One Essential Mix moved across the road to record the famous Sasha set in Amnesia in 1996 and have consistently worked together ever since; presenting a taste of Ibiza on the airwaves. There has been the odd defection of course, Radio One at Pacha in 1999, Manumission in 2001/02 and 2005 for a huge anniversary event at Space.

Cafe Mambo has hosted live broadcasts during sunsets and one-off festivals that have occurred throughout the years. With all the logistical and production arrangements over a 15 year period, sometimes things don’t go as planned, for instance, the scheduling of Carl Cox at Space, I don’t see a problem there, was followed by Gilles Peterson. Then there was the year a certain Radio One presenter indulged in a bit too much Ibiza high life and didn’t make the live broadcast. Or the early days when chewing gum and Sellotape seems to hold the live set up together while Pete Tong spoke to the world on a Friday night.

It all adds to what is great about the relationship between Ibiza and Radio One. No matter how hard you plan, Ibiza is one of those places that refuses to go to plan, and always has something special in-store.

Overall, the Radio One Ibiza weekend brings with it a reputation to the peak season. Talk of Ibiza’s appeal waning isn’t mentioned in the arrivals lounge. This year’s dates are yet to be announced but the good money is 30th July – 1st August. So if you find yourself on the island, make sure you tune yourself in and attend one of the events that Pete Tong, Annie Mac et al. will be hosting.
